Transaction 960576867a106391ef380cbd48ad2abae4fc5ee198fcf568a72adeae96c604fe
1 Input
1 Output
-
960576867a106391ef380cbd48ad2abae4fc5ee198fcf568a72adeae96c604fe:0
- value
- 314822750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49b65a805ce6bcf138198c2d32230fc1814592bb OP_EQUAL
- address
- MEcv1aWbs4Us9B47hkEjgDYc5qcN6hYVR2